    It's a tricky one. Normally you'd expect a medium to be as big as you'd want for 5' 9" but you might find it quite short. There'll be plenty of standover room on a large, due to the frame design, so it's down to top tube. I've got a medium and I'm five ten, but initially I found it very "not stretched out". Medium is still probably your best choice.

    Go for a medium unless your wildly out of proportion! We sell loads of SJ FSRs every year, I tend to find them to be a little bit smaller than most for a given size but at 5'10 i find myself inbetween M&L (ive ridden both sizes from our demo fleet comfortably) but would probably opt for a medium if it was my own money.

    However there is still no better sizing tool than getting your arse on a saddle and having a go 😉
